How much do music video production jobs pay per hour?

As of Jun 8, 2026, the average hourly pay for music video production in the United States is $24.75,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$16.59 and $29.33 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What does a typical day look like for someone working in Music Video Production?

A typical day in Music Video Production can be quite dynamic and varies depending on the phase of the project. During pre-production, you might focus on planning shoots, scouting locations, and coordinating with directors, artists, and crew members. On shoot days, you'll be actively involved in setting up equipment, directing scenes, and managing on-set logistics. Post-production work often involves editing footage, collaborating with visual effects artists, and making revisions based on feedback from the artist or client. Collaboration and adaptability are key, as schedules and creative direction can change rapidly to meet project goals.

What does a Music Video Production job involve?

A Music Video Production job involves planning, filming, and editing music videos for artists and bands. Responsibilities can include coordinating shoots, directing performers, managing lighting and camera crews, and editing footage to match the song's theme. Professionals in this field may work with record labels, independent artists, or video production companies. Strong skills in visual storytelling, cinematography, and post-production are essential to creating engaging and high-quality music videos.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the Music Video Production position, and why are they important?

To thrive in Music Video Production, you need expertise in video direction, cinematography, editing, and an understanding of music and visual storytelling, often supported by a degree in film, media production, or related experience. Familiarity with professional camera equipment, lighting setups, Adobe Creative Suite (including Premiere Pro and After Effects), and project management tools is highly valuable. Creativity, strong communication, teamwork, and the ability to work under tight deadlines set standout professionals apart. These skills are essential for delivering high-quality music videos that capture an artist's vision and connect with audiences effectively.
